How much do senior devsecops engineer jobs pay per year?

As of Aug 13, 2026, the average yearly pay for senior devsecops engineer in Houston, TX is $120,858.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$99,800.00 and $137,000.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What does a Senior DevSecOps Engineer do?

A Senior DevSecOps Engineer works closely with both development and security teams to embed security practices throughout the software development lifecycle. This collaboration often involves conducting threat modeling sessions, integrating automated security testing tools into CI/CD pipelines, and providing guidance on secure coding practices. Regular communication and joint problem-solving are key to ensuring that security measures do not hinder development speed, while still maintaining robust protection for applications and infrastructure. This role often acts as a bridge between teams, translating security requirements into actionable steps for developers and ensuring compliance with industry standards.

What is a Senior DevSecOps Engineer?

Senior DevSecOps Engineers are experienced IT professionals who integrate security practices into every phase of the software development and deployment process. They work at the intersection of development, operations, and security, ensuring that applications are secure, scalable, and efficiently delivered. Their responsibilities include automating security checks, managing infrastructure as code, overseeing compliance requirements, and mentoring teams on secure coding and deployment practices. Senior DevSecOps Engineers also evaluate and implement security tools, respond to incidents, and help create a culture of security within the organization.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Senior DevSecOps Engineer?

To thrive as a Senior DevSecOps Engineer, you need expertise in cloud infrastructure, automation, secure software development, and a strong background in cybersecurity, often backed by a degree in computer science or a related field. Familiarity with tools like Jenkins, Terraform, Docker, Kubernetes, and security frameworks such as NIST, as well as certifications like AWS Certified DevOps Engineer or CISSP, is highly valued. Strong problem-solving abilities, collaboration, and clear communication distinguish top performers in this role. These skills are essential to seamlessly integrate security into the development lifecycle, ensuring robust, scalable, and compliant systems.

What You'll Do
Are you passionate about embedding security into every stage of the development lifecycle while building scalable, high-impact cloud solutions?
As a Senior DevSecOps Engineer II, you'll play a critical role within the Practice Solutions team, partnering across development, quality assurance, infrastructure, and security to design and deliver secure, automated, and resilient technology solutions. Reporting to the Director of Technology, this role blends hands-on technical expertise with strategic influence-driving DevSecOps maturity, improving release efficiency, and strengthening the organization's security posture across cloud and delivery pipelines.
This is an opportunity to lead through innovation, mentor peers, and shape how secure software is built and deployed at scale.
โ€ข Secure CI/CD Enablement: Design, build, and maintain secure continuous integration/continuous delivery (CI/CD) pipelines that streamline application build, testing, and deployment.
โ€ข Security Integration: Embed security tooling into the software development lifecycle, including Static Application Security Testing (SAST), Dynamic Application Security Testing (DAST), Software Composition Analysis (SCA), secrets scanning, and infrastructure security scanning.
โ€ข Infrastructure as Code (IaC): Develop and manage infrastructure using code with tools such as Terraform, Bicep, Azure Resource Manager (ARM), or CloudFormation.
โ€ข Cloud Security Management: Administer and secure cloud environments, primarily within Microsoft Azure, ensuring compliance and operational integrity.
โ€ข Container & Kubernetes Security: Implement and manage container and orchestration security, including image scanning, role-based access control (RBAC), and runtime protections.
โ€ข Standards & Governance: Establish and enforce secure coding, deployment, and access management standards across teams.
โ€ข Identity & Secrets Management: Secure and manage certificates, secrets, and identity/access controls using enterprise tools and best practices.
โ€ข Monitoring & Observability: Track system health and performance using monitoring and alerting platforms to proactively identify and resolve issues.
โ€ข Vulnerability Management: Coordinate remediation efforts and support compliance and regulatory initiatives.
โ€ข Troubleshooting & Optimization: Resolve production and deployment challenges and contribute to root cause analysis and continuous improvement.
โ€ข Automation: Streamline operational processes through scripting using tools such as PowerShell, Bash, or Python.
โ€ข Collaboration & Influence: Partner cross-functionally to enhance reliability, release quality, and security maturity across the organization.
โ€ข Mentorship & Advocacy: Guide engineers and champion DevSecOps best practices, fostering a culture of continuous learning and improvement.
What You'll Bring
โ€ข Education: Bachelor's degree in Computer Science or a related field, or equivalent practical experience.
โ€ข Experience: 8+ years in DevOps, Cloud Engineering, Systems Engineering, or DevSecOps, including 5+ years integrating security into CI/CD pipelines.
โ€ข DevSecOps Expertise: Deep experience with CI/CD platforms (e.g., Azure DevOps, GitHub Actions, Jenkins, GitLab) and embedding security controls throughout development workflows.
โ€ข Cloud & Infrastructure Knowledge: Strong experience with cloud platforms (especially Microsoft Azure and/or AWS) and Infrastructure as Code practices.
โ€ข Containerization & Orchestration: Hands-on experience with Docker and Kubernetes, including security best practices.
โ€ข Security Fundamentals: Solid understanding of application security concepts, secrets management, authentication protocols, and policy enforcement tools (e.g., Azure Policy, Open Policy Agent (OPA), Sentinel).
โ€ข Scripting & Automation: Proficiency in scripting languages such as PowerShell, Python, or Bash to drive automation and efficiency.
โ€ข Systems & Networking: Strong foundation in operating systems, networking, APIs, and distributed systems.
โ€ข Monitoring & Observability Tools: Experience with platforms such as Dynatrace, Prometheus, Grafana, ELK Stack (Elasticsearch, Logstash, Kibana), Splunk, or Azure Monitor.
โ€ข Collaboration & Communication: Excellent problem-solving, communication, and relationship-building skills, with the ability to influence cross-functional teams in a fast-paced environment.
